Отрицательные значения регистра остатков #405712


#0 by maksimili
Здравствуйте. Я работаю над своей первой конфигурацией и у меня есть вопрос. Как лучше защитить регистр остатков от отрицательных значений, например если удаляются документы по приходу, а документы по расходу остаются.
#1 by Nickolaich
как минимум запретить редактировать документы "задним числом"
#2 by Злопчинский
Оч.просто. 1. Метод, действующий на 100% Вычислить кто удалил приход, по которому есть расход. Привести и отрубить нахрен руку. Отрубленную руку с надписью "он не внял запретам администрации" вывесить в центре комнаты. 2. Метод на 50% Просто ликвидировать саму возможность удаления и изменения проведенных документов. Нех ибо пох потому как нах
#3 by GreyK
Вот здесь по бухии, но смысл тот-же:
#4 by mad hatter
наивный децкий вопрос. а чем мешают отрицательные остатки?
#5 by Злопчинский
Отрицательные остатки мешают тем же самым, как например отрицательные резервы - простым подходом разработчиков... например остатки=10, резервы=-3 - ну вот так вот получилось! . в типовой ТиС считается тупо! Можно=Остатки-Резервы, нигде не проверяя "остатки" и "резервы" на допустимость значений...
#6 by Злопчинский
С другой стороны, например, существование отрицательных резервов можно рассматривать как (бесприоритетный!)заказ под будущие поставки...
#7 by Impressing3
А вот вопрос такой к вам - вот у нас получается 2 дока  - пришел-ушел. И допустим отменяем проведение прихода....А насколько коряво посмотреть на ТА сразу перед отменением проведения что по нему уже был расход в принципе и не дать отменять проведение пока не отменится проведение расхода? Или можно ли прямо тут же найти эти все доки движения (расхода) до ТА и отменить их проведение вместе с этим доком?....вооот..чет думаю...
#8 by ALBA2009
А что мешает разграничить полномочия?
#9 by Aleksey_3
Ну а если были партии, запрос по партиям этого документа на наличие движения быстро отработает
#10 by Jungo
можно, делай проверку есть ли в регистре то что значится в документе. Если нету - запретить распроведение. Только это как то все некрасиво... Мне больше нравится вот этот вариант - это для совсем криворуких пользователей, а для тех у кого руки получше - вот этот вариант .
#11 by Jungo
В продолжение: нужно учить пользователей работать правильно.
#12 by maksimili
er
#13 by у лю 427
перед отменой дока ПРИХОД смотрим - есть ли в регистре движения по созданным им партиям на РАСХОД. если есть хоть одно движение - пусть сначала удалят его - потом отменяют приход...
#14 by mrkorn
вопрос на засыпку - а в твоем методе работы задним числом - что будет, если удалят Приходную накладную?
#15 by SergoOd
Так он именно это и написал...
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С